Jacques Villon Cubist Original Etching, 1951, “Figure de Femme”

About the Item

Jacques Villon original etching “Figure de Femme” in the Cubist Surreal style. Hand signed and numbered. Small Edition, created 1951. Edition of 30 of which this print is no. 21. Unmatted and unframed. Measures: 9 3/4" H x 7 1/2" W - image size. In excellent condition. A painter and printmaker, Jacques Villon was known for his Cubist-style works. He first came to the attention of the American public when his work was included in the 1913 New York Armory Show, which introduced modernism to the United States. All of his work sold at this exhibition. Jacques Villon was born Gaston Duchamp in 1875 in Normandy, France. He learned to engrave from his grandfather, Emile Frederic Nicolle and in the summer of 1894 he studied at L'Ecole des Beaux-Arts. In 1891 Villon, at the age of 16, executed an etching of his father Eugene Duchamp, "Portrait de Mon Pere." It was exhibited in 1953 at the Museum of Modern Art, New York, and in Paris in 1959 as well as various other major museums throughout France and the United States. Jacques Villon received honors at various international exhibitions, including first prize at the Carnegie Institute in Pittsburgh in 1950. He died on June 9, 1963, at the age of eighty-seven in Puteaux, France.
